Welcome to the ParityScope team. ParityScope crawls partner booking sites nightly and flags hotel rates that drift from our contracted floor. New hires should start by reading the crawler config guide and running a dry-run against the staging dataset. Access requests go through the Fennimore portal. For onboarding questions, contact the team here.

escalation mailbox, bafog-fafog: ulador@paliqlabs.internal

Hello plugin authors,

Next Thursday, Corbexa will run a disaster-recovery drill for the RestockRoute vending-machine restock planner. During the failover window, plugin callbacks will be replayed against the standby scheduler, so please ensure your handlers are idempotent and tolerate duplicate route assignments. No customer restock data will be altered. To re-register your plugin against the standby environment during the drill, authenticate with the recovery passphrase provided below.

vault phrase of hahip-tajeg = quenax-briath-briax

// Broker upgrade notes for plugin authors:
// Quillbus 4.x replaces the legacy 3.x wire protocol. Plugins must
// construct the client with explicit protocol negotiation enabled,
// or connections to the Larkfield cluster will be silently downgraded
// and dropped after 30s. Topic names are unchanged. For local testing
// against the sandbox broker, authenticate with the key below.

API key for bafof-bagaf: qvz2-qi

## Authentication

Canary deploys of the Lanternfall auth service gate on two checks: token validation error rate below 0.5% and p99 latency under 120ms across a 15-minute window. Reviewers should confirm both thresholds in the gating config before approving. The canary verifier authenticates against the internal metrics service using the key below.

service key, fajog-fahag: kto11_2MzOs43qWZq